MICROCAPITAL BRIEF: Smart Payment Solutions to Offer Debit, Prepaid Cards in Zimbabwe

Smart Payment Solutions, a Zimbabwe-based company, is introducing a cashless banking system that will allow paperless transactions through the use of prepaid and debit cards issued through retail and community agents. The fee structure and related details are unavailable.

According to FinScope Consumer Survey Zimbabwe 2011, a report by a local unit of nonprofit financial inclusion advocacy group Finmark Trust of South Africa, 40 percent of Zimbabwe’s population is financially excluded, with 12 percent of the rural population accessing banking services.

About FinScope Trust
Established in 2002 in South Africa, FinMark Trust is a nonprofit, independent trust funded primarily by the UK’s Department for International Development (DfID). Its main goal is to “make financial markets work for the poor, by promoting financial inclusion and regional financial integration.” It does so by conducting research on financial policy and regulation, savings, consumer financial empowerment, housing finance and payment systems. FinScope Trust works in 12 countries in Africa.
